Article ID: 273428 - Last Review: December 3, 2007 - Revision: 3.5 Error Message When You Restart Exchange Services If Global Catalog Cannot Be Contacted
This article was previously published under Q273428 SYMPTOMS
When you try to restart the Exchange services, you may receive the following error message:
Could not start the Microsoft Exchange System Attendant service on Local Computer. Error 1053: The service did not respond to the start or control request in a timely fashion.
Event Type: Error Event Source: MSExchangeDSAccess Event Category: None Event ID: 2064 Date: 7/6/2001 Time: 2:16:31 PM User: N/A Computer: COMPUTER Description: Process <process name>.EXE (PID=2040). All the remote DS Servers in use are not responding.
-and-
Event Type: Error Event Source: MSExchangeSA Event Category: General Event ID: 1005 Date: 7/6/2001 Time: 2:19:47 PM User: N/A Computer: COMPUTER Description: Unexpected error The specified domain either does not exist or could not be contacted. Facility: Win32 ID no: c007054b Microsoft Exchange System Attendant occurred. CAUSE
This issue may occur if the Exchange server is installed on a member server in a child domain with no Global Catalog server in it. One of the following has occurred:
RESOLUTION
Restore all connectivity between the Exchange server, the domain controller or controllers in the child domain, and the Global Catalog server or servers in the root domain.
STATUSMicrosoft has confirmed that this is a problem in Microsoft Exchange 2000 Server. MORE INFORMATION
When an Exchange service starts, it contacts a domain controller in its local domain by using DSAccess. The domain controller, if it is not also a Global Catalog server, uses DSProxy to connect to a Global Catalog server. A Global Catalog server must be contacted for the Exchange service to get the context that it needs to start.
